Understanding the Technology Behind iPhone Camera Detectors

iPhone camera detectors rely on a combination of hardware and software to accurately detect and capture images. The key components include the camera sensor, image signal processor (ISP), and computational photography algorithms.

See also  How to get more filters on iphone camera

Camera Sensor

The camera sensor captures light and converts it into digital signals. iPhones are equipped with advanced sensors that can capture high-resolution images with great detail and color accuracy.

Image Signal Processor (ISP)

The ISP processes the raw image data captured by the sensor to enhance the quality of the image. It adjusts parameters such as exposure, white balance, and noise reduction to produce a visually appealing image.

Computational Photography Algorithms

iPhones use sophisticated algorithms to further enhance images. Features like Smart HDR, Night Mode, and Deep Fusion leverage AI and machine learning to improve image quality in various lighting conditions.
